GUYRA RESIDENTS WANT THEIR COUNCIL BACK

Meanwhile Guyra residents have launched a petition to re-instate the town as a stand alone council, as Gladys Berejiklian takes up her new role as New South Wales Premier.
Guyra was forced to amalgamate with Armidale in May last year, with the joint body known as Armidale Regional Council.
The petition will be circulated around the state among calls for all forced council mergers in New South Wales to be reversed.
Member for Northern Tablelands Adam Marshall has signalled his support for the petition.
